7% Tip on $446 Bill
7% tip on a $446 bill: $31.22. Free tip calculator with split bill option.
$31.22
Tip = $446 x (7/100) = $31.22. Total with tip = $477.22.
How This Was Calculated
Tip Amount: Tip = Bill ร (Tip% / 100)
Total: Total = Bill + Tip
Per Person: Per Person = Total / Number of People
